Transaction 323a02c8125895252e79cb702f0937079a2cf41ce6b9aa333c2a8d73cc7f3cb1

1 Input
2 Outputs
  • 323a02c8125895252e79cb702f0937079a2cf41ce6b9aa333c2a8d73cc7f3cb1:0
  • value  522764
    address  3DV97cSkioZfHvFeWsBy8VCcoU6mJaVFov
  • 323a02c8125895252e79cb702f0937079a2cf41ce6b9aa333c2a8d73cc7f3cb1:1
  • value  73069137
    address  1842mqN6Etzkf2vKNttErh9Te8dRoNpdMy